Ubuntu disables Intel GPU security mitigations, promises 20% performance boost

Spectre, you may recall, came to public notice in 2018. Spectre attacks are based on the observation that performance enhancements built into modern CPUs open a side channel that can leak secrets a CPU is processing. The performance enhancement, known as speculative execution, predicts future instructions a CPU might receive and then performs the corresponding tasks before they are even called. If the instructions never come, the CPU discards the work it performed. When the prediction is correct, the CPU has already completed the task.

The Case of Hidden Spam Pages

Spammy posts and pages being placed on WordPress websites is one of the most common infections that we come across. The reason being is that the attack is very low-level in terms of sophistication: All that is required of the attacker is to brute force their way into the wp-admin panel; from there they just have their scripts/bots post spam posts and pages effectively achieving a blackhat SEO attack. Since an out-of-the-box WordPress website contains no protection on admin access other than a password (with no limit on the number of failed login attempts), and the admin users can often be discovered via enumeration, this remains a very popular type of spam infection on the platform.

Decrement by one to rule them all: AsIO3.sys driver exploitation

Armory Crate and AI Suite are applications used to manage and monitor ASUS motherboards and related components such as the processor, RAM or the increasingly popular RGB lighting. These types of applications often install drivers in the system, which are necessary for direct communication with hardware to configure settings or retrieve critical parameters such as CPU temperature, fan speeds and firmware updates. Therefore, it is critical to ensure that drivers are well-written with security in mind and designed such that access to the driver interfaces are limited only to certain services and administrators.

Notepad++ Vulnerability Allows Full System Takeover - PoC Released

A critical privilege escalation vulnerability (CVE-2025-49144) in Notepad++ v8.8.1 enables attackers to achieve full system control through a supply-chain attack. The flaw exploits the installer-s insecure search path behavior, allowing unprivileged users to escalate privileges to NT AUTHORITY\SYSTEM with minimal user interaction. This marks one of the most severe vulnerabilities discovered in the popular text editor, with proof-of-concept (PoC) exploitation materials now publicly available.

Security Advisory: Airoha-based Bluetooth Headphones and Earbuds

During our research on Bluetooth headphones and earbuds, we identified several vulnerabilities in devices that incorporate Airoha Systems on a Chip (SoCs). In this blog post, we briefly want to describe the vulnerabilities, point out their impact and provide some context to currently running patch delivery processes as described at this year-s TROOPERS Conference. Airoha is a vendor that, amongst other things, builds Bluetooth SoCs and offers reference designs and implementations incorporating these chips. They have become a large supplier in the Bluetooth audio space, especially in the area of True Wireless Stereo (TWS) earbuds. Several reputable headphone and earbud vendors have built products based on Airoha-s SoCs and reference implementations using Airoha-s Software Development Kit (SDK).
